At first they are going to be unsigned and unframed. Probably sell for around $20 each. We have done the autograph thing and split the money with the players before the only problem was after paying for printing, shipping and all the hassle of keeping everything straight it just wasn't worth the effort.

We may do something in the future on site at events with autographed stuff. We'll just have to see.

As far as the framing, to ship something in a frame is a pain and expensive and the whole point we kept running into is that people like the posters but do not want to spend $100 on one.To print, frame, pack and ship a 16x20 or 18x24 poster for any less than that makes no sense so we are just going to do the posters themselves. We may start bringing a couple framed and autographed posters to events and either auctioning or raffling them off.
